    My favorite recipe is taco stuffed peppers. Just green peppers etuffed with a mixture of ground beef, salsa, taco seasoning, mexican cheese, sour cream and i add a tblsp of mayo. Cut green peppers in half either horizontally or vertically. Put green peppers in microwave with some water to soften about 10 min. Then drain and put in baking dish and stuff with meat mixture. Top with cheese and bake at 350 for 15-20 min. Delicious and low carb.

    Cheese that is sliced or grated at home melts much better because pre-grated cheese that’s bought in the stores grated has chemical “stuff” on it that prevents the cheese from sticking to itself, but sadly that same “stuff” also prevents the cheese from melting as well.     Try my 7 Layer Nachos:
    In a large roasting pan, place these ingredients in the following order.
    --- In the bottom of the pan, spread a can of refried beans.
    --- On the beans, place 1.5 to 2 lbs. hamburger, browned and drained of grease.
    --- On top of the meat, spread 2 jars of salsa.
    --- On the salsa, place 2 lbs. of grated cheese; 1 lb. of Monterey jack, 1 lb. of cheddar.
    --- On top of the cheese, carefully spread 2 tubs of sour cream; this is the tricky part, spreading the cream so that the cheese stays under it.
    --- Sprinkle 1 bunch of chopped green onions on top of the sour cream.
    --- Sprinkle one small can, drained, of sliced black olives on top of the sour cream.
    Bake in the oven preheated to 400 degrees for 45 minutes. Let rest for 15 minutes.
    This is a party recipe, and it's usually served by scooping some out onto a plate and eating it with tortilla chips. However, to avoid the carbs in the chips, it can be eaten alone.
